Chris is on HRT and most treatments actually stop/prevent genetic hair loss by blocking DHT production that causes the follicles to shrink and die. Although, once the follicle dies, there's no saving it aside from replacement via a transplant. So while Chris is never going to get a super feminine, juvenile hairline without surgery, the balding has likely stopped.

Of course, for most men that don't go on HRT. For thinning hair, a foam minoxidil (commonly known as Rogaine) works well and has little to no adverse side effects. More advanced cases are best treated with a pill-form medication such as finasteride or more aggressive dutasteride. Both are fairly safe and don't mess you up hormonally like HRT does.
